TOPICAL GUIDE
Serpent
Gen. 3: 1 (Moses 4: 5) serpent was more subtil than any beast.
Gen. 49: 17 Dan shall be a serpent by the way.
Ex. 4: 3 it became a serpent, and Moses fled from before it.
Num. 21: 6 (Deut. 8: 15; 1 Ne. 17: 41) Lord sent fiery serpents among the people.
Num. 21: 8 Lord said unto Moses, Make thee a fiery serpent.
Num. 21: 9 Moses made a serpent of brass.
2 Kgs. 18: 4 brake in pieces the brasen serpent.
Job 26: 13 his hand hath formed the crooked serpent.
Ps. 140: 3 They have sharpened their tongues like a serpent.
Isa. 14: 29 (2 Ne. 24: 29) his fruit shall be a fiery flying serpent.
Isa. 65: 25 dust shall be the serpent’s meat.
Jer. 8: 17 I will send serpents, cockatrices, among you.
Amos 9: 3 I command the serpent, and he shall bite them.
Matt. 7: 10 (Luke 11: 11; 3 Ne. 14: 10) if he ask a fish, will he give him a serpent.
Matt. 10: 16 (D&C 111: 11) wise as serpents, and harmless as doves.
Matt. 23: 33 Ye serpents, ye generation of vipers.
Mark 16: 18 (Morm. 9: 24; D&C 84: 72; D&C 124: 99) They shall take up serpents . . . not hurt them.
Luke 10: 19 unto you power to tread on serpents.
John 3: 14 as Moses lifted up the serpent . . . so must the Son of man.
2 Cor. 11: 3 as the serpent beguiled Eve . . . so your minds should be corrupted.
Rev. 12: 9 great dragon was cast out, that old serpent . . . the Devil.
Rev. 20: 2 he laid hold on . . . that old serpent . . . and bound him a thousand years.
2 Ne. 2: 18 (Mosiah 16: 3) he said unto Eve, yea, even that old serpent.
2 Ne. 25: 20 cast their eyes unto the serpent which he did raise.
Hel. 8: 14 brazen serpent in the wilderness, even so should he be lifted up who should come.
Ether 9: 33 Lord did cause the serpents that they should pursue them.
D&C 76: 28 we beheld Satan, that old serpent.
D&C 88: 110 Satan shall be bound, that old serpent.
Moses 4: 7 he spake by the mouth of the serpent.
